Reading the GDT after a win like this is an experience. This is a very fatalistic fanbase for sure, though perhaps with good reason. Its not like there have not been reasons to expect first game disasters!!!! But in a 54 page GDT at about page 44 you would have thought the team was down 5-0 and completely outclassed with most of the players being total trash. Nurse for example was on the ice for 12SF 2SA, 2GF 0GA, 18SCF 5SCA, 7HDCF and 0 HDCA but from the comments you would think he struggled. A lot of this is passion but it is also a lot about instant analysis of every play with a razor focus on every perceived mistake.

Beat the Kings in Games 5 and 6 with one non-empty net point total from McDrai and got the game winning and icing goal from lines 2 and 3 on "goal scorer" type goals, no flukes with either. That's some serious depth coming up big in big games.
If Ekholm returns, this is the deepest forward and defense group the Oilers have had since I've been following Oilers hockey in my nearly 30 years of watching, Emberson and Stecher would be the 7/8, that's some super impressive depth. Just need to get average goaltending from Pickard and sky is the limit.

This team is no longer just holding on when the 2nd to 4th lines are on the ice and waiting for McDrai. They're pushing the pace and, what's more, they can play it any way the opposition wants to. There's smarts (RNH, Henrique, Janmark), physical play (Frederic, Kane, Podkolzin) and scoring (Brown, Hyman) everywhere.
